mirror of
https://gitlab.com/allianceauth/allianceauth.git
synced 2026-02-12 18:16:24 +01:00
150 lines
8.4 KiB
HTML
150 lines
8.4 KiB
HTML
{% extends "allianceauth/base.html" %}
|
|
{% load staticfiles %}
|
|
{% load i18n %}
|
|
{% load evelinks %}
|
|
|
|
{% block page_title %}{% trans "Groups Management" %}{% endblock page_title %}
|
|
{% block extra_css %}
|
|
<style>
|
|
.nav-tabs>li.active>a {
|
|
background-color: #ECF0F1 !important;
|
|
color: #2C3E50;
|
|
}
|
|
</style>
|
|
|
|
{% endblock extra_css %}
|
|
|
|
{% block content %}
|
|
<div class="col-lg-12">
|
|
<br>
|
|
{% include 'groupmanagement/menu.html' %}
|
|
|
|
<ul class="nav nav-tabs">
|
|
<li class="active"><a data-toggle="tab" href="#add">{% trans "Join Requests" %}</a></li>
|
|
<li><a data-toggle="tab" href="#leave">{% trans "Leave Requests" %}</a></li>
|
|
</ul>
|
|
|
|
<div class="tab-content">
|
|
|
|
<div id="add" class="tab-pane fade in active panel panel-default">
|
|
<div class="panel-body">
|
|
{% if acceptrequests %}
|
|
<div class="table-responsive">
|
|
<table class="table table-aa">
|
|
<thead>
|
|
<tr>
|
|
<th class="text-center"></th>
|
|
<th class="text-center">{% trans "Character" %}</th>
|
|
<th class="text-center">{% trans "Organization" %}</th>
|
|
<th class="text-center">{% trans "Group" %}</th>
|
|
<th class="text-center"></th>
|
|
</tr>
|
|
</thead>
|
|
<tbody>
|
|
{% for acceptrequest in acceptrequests %}
|
|
<tr>
|
|
<td class="text-right">
|
|
<img src="{{ acceptrequest.main_char|character_portrait_url:32 }}" class="img-circle">
|
|
</td>
|
|
<td class="text-center">
|
|
{% if acceptrequest.main_char %}
|
|
<a href="{{ acceptrequest.main_char|evewho_character_url }}" target="_blank">
|
|
{{ acceptrequest.main_char.character_name }}
|
|
</a>
|
|
{% else %}
|
|
{{ acceptrequest.user.username }}
|
|
{% endif %}
|
|
</td>
|
|
<td class="text-center">
|
|
{% if acceptrequest.main_char %}
|
|
<a href="{{ acceptrequest.main_char|dotlan_corporation_url }}" target="_blank">
|
|
{{ acceptrequest.main_char.corporation_name }}
|
|
</a><br>
|
|
{{ acceptrequest.main_char.alliance_name|default_if_none:"" }}
|
|
{% else %}
|
|
(unknown)
|
|
{% endif %}
|
|
</td>
|
|
<td class="text-center">{{ acceptrequest.group.name }}</td>
|
|
<td class="text-center">
|
|
<a href="{% url 'groupmanagement:accept_request' acceptrequest.id %}" class="btn btn-success">
|
|
{% trans "Accept" %}
|
|
</a>
|
|
<a href="{% url 'groupmanagement:reject_request' acceptrequest.id %}" class="btn btn-danger">
|
|
{% trans "Reject" %}
|
|
</a>
|
|
</td>
|
|
</tr>
|
|
{% endfor %}
|
|
</tbody>
|
|
</table>
|
|
</div>
|
|
{% else %}
|
|
<div class="alert alert-warning text-center">{% trans "No group add requests." %}</div>
|
|
{% endif %}
|
|
</div>
|
|
</div>
|
|
|
|
<div id="leave" class="tab-pane fade panel panel-default">
|
|
<div class="panel-body">
|
|
{% if leaverequests %}
|
|
<div class="table-responsive">
|
|
<table class="table table-aa">
|
|
<thead>
|
|
<tr>
|
|
<th class="text-center"></th>
|
|
<th class="text-center">{% trans "Character" %}</th>
|
|
<th class="text-center">{% trans "Organization" %}</th>
|
|
<th class="text-center">{% trans "Group" %}</th>
|
|
<th class="text-center"></th>
|
|
</tr>
|
|
</thead>
|
|
<tbody>
|
|
{% for leaverequest in leaverequests %}
|
|
<tr>
|
|
<td class="text-right">
|
|
<img src="{{ leaverequest.main_char|character_portrait_url:32 }}" class="img-circle">
|
|
</td>
|
|
<td class="text-center">
|
|
{% if leaverequest.main_char %}
|
|
<a href="{{ leaverequest.main_char|evewho_character_url }}" target="_blank">
|
|
{{ leaverequest.main_char.character_name }}
|
|
</a>
|
|
{% else %}
|
|
{{ leaverequest.user.username }}
|
|
{% endif %}
|
|
</td>
|
|
<td class="text-center">
|
|
{% if leaverequest.main_char %}
|
|
<a href="{{ leaverequest.main_char|dotlan_corporation_url }}" target="_blank">
|
|
{{ leaverequest.main_char.corporation_name }}
|
|
</a><br>
|
|
{{ leaverequest.main_char.alliance_name|default_if_none:"" }}
|
|
{% else %}
|
|
(unknown)
|
|
{% endif %}
|
|
</td>
|
|
<td class="text-center">{{ leaverequest.group.name }}</td>
|
|
<td class="text-center">
|
|
<a href="{% url 'groupmanagement:leave_accept_request' leaverequest.id %}" class="btn btn-success">
|
|
{% trans "Accept" %}
|
|
</a>
|
|
<a href="{% url 'groupmanagement:leave_reject_request' leaverequest.id %}" class="btn btn-danger">
|
|
{% trans "Reject" %}
|
|
</a>
|
|
</td>
|
|
</tr>
|
|
{% endfor %}
|
|
</tbody>
|
|
</table>
|
|
</div>
|
|
{% else %}
|
|
<div class="alert alert-warning text-center">{% trans "No group leave requests." %}</div>
|
|
{% endif %}
|
|
</div>
|
|
</div>
|
|
|
|
</div>
|
|
</div>
|
|
{% endblock content %}
|